Anza- Borrego Desert State Park’s rugged landscape formed largely by the forces of erosion attacking the uplifted mountains. The higher the mountains rise, the more vigorously they are attacked by rain, snow, ice, and wind, as they yield to the constant pull of ... WebJul 23, 2016 · This hike is located near Winkleman, AZ. To get to the West trailhead: from the Phoenix area, take US-60 East toward Superior, AZ. At Superior, turn South on HWY-177 towards Winkleman. Continue South on HWY-77 for about 11 miles to signed Aravaipa Canyon Road on your left. WebTucson Mountain Park is approx. 20,000 acres with approx. 62 miles of non-motorized trails for hiking, mountain biking and horseback riding. Great for birding and wildlife viewing. ...
